Arcade Gaming in the Early ’90s
The year was 1992, and the arcade scene was thriving. Gamers across the globe flocked to dimly lit arcades, quarters in hand, ready to face off against adversaries in one-on-one combat games. It was in this environment that Midway Games, now known as NetherRealm Studios, introduced Mortal Kombat.

Street Fighter II: The Birth of the Fighting Game Genre
Street Fighter II, released in 1991, revolutionized arcade gaming. It introduced the concept of one-on-one fighting, allowing players to select characters with unique abilities and special moves. This innovation birthed the fighting game genre, leading to numerous imitators and a competitive scene that thrives to this day.
Mortal Kombat: Controversy and Carnage
Mortal Kombat, unleashed in 1992, stirred controversy with its gruesome fatalities and realistic digitized graphics. Despite the controversy, or perhaps because of it, Mortal Kombat became an instant hit. It pushed the boundaries of what was acceptable in gaming and showcased the medium’s potential for storytelling through brutal combat.

Mortal Kombat was a game-changer, quite literally. It distinguished itself from its competitors with a unique blend of digitized actors, realistic graphics, and a control scheme that was easy to pick up but difficult to master. However, it was the game’s brutal fatalities that set it apart. Players could finish off their opponents in the most gruesome ways imaginable, a feature that would soon become both its trademark and a source of controversy.

The Birth of Iconic Characters:
Mortal Kombat introduced players to a diverse cast of characters, each with their own fighting style and background story. From the thunder god Raiden to the ice-wielding ninja Sub-Zero, these characters became household names and laid the foundation for the game’s enduring success. The combination of engaging gameplay and memorable characters ensured that Mortal Kombat would not remain confined to the arcade.
Mortal Kombat’s Controversial Reputation:
As Mortal Kombat’s popularity soared, so did the controversy surrounding it. Concerned parents and politicians decried the game’s violence, leading to the establishment of the Entertainment Software Rating Board (ESRB) in 1994. The ESRB’s rating system, still in use today, was a direct response to the moral panic caused by Mortal Kombat and other violent games of the era.
The Genesis of Home Console Versions:
To capitalize on its growing fanbase, Mortal Kombat made its way to home consoles, starting with the Sega Genesis and Super Nintendo Entertainment System (SNES). However, this transition was not without its challenges. The SNES version of the game had to censor the fatalities, replacing the iconic blood with sweat and removing some of the more graphic finishers. In contrast, the Genesis version retained the violence, sparking the infamous “console wars” of the time.
Sequels and Innovations:
Throughout the ’90s and early 2000s, Mortal Kombat continued to evolve with sequels and spin-offs. Mortal Kombat II, Mortal Kombat 3, and Mortal Kombat 4 introduced new characters, stages, and gameplay mechanics. The series expanded its lore, delving deeper into the mythology of the Mortal Kombat universe.
One of the most significant innovations came in the form of 3D gameplay with titles like Mortal Kombat: Deadly Alliance and Mortal Kombat: Deception. These games brought a new level of depth to the series while retaining the signature Mortal Kombat style.
Mortal Kombat in Pop Culture:
Mortal Kombat’s influence extended beyond gaming. It spawned movies, comic books, action figures, and even a techno theme song that became an anthem for fans. The 1995 live-action Mortal Kombat film and its sequel, Mortal Kombat: Annihilation, brought the franchise to the big screen, albeit with mixed critical reception. Nonetheless, these adaptations contributed to the series’ cultural impact.
The Reboot and Resurgence:
The mid-2000s marked a period of decline for Mortal Kombat. The series lost some of its luster with a string of less successful titles. However, a reboot in 2011, simply titled “Mortal Kombat,” revitalized the franchise. The game returned to its roots, combining classic 2D gameplay with modern graphics and storytelling.
The Competitive Scene
Mortal Kombat found a new lease on life in the competitive gaming world. Esports tournaments and a dedicated fanbase breathed fresh energy into the series. Mortal Kombat X and Mortal Kombat 11 continued to refine the formula, offering a balance of accessibility for casual players and depth for competitive gamers.
